Output 84fe558ef90108a02131f0e406b9f5162c8d14cb4ae9565fce0b0247b6f1ff11:1

value
692569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 796de2ccc4e245c9e216ab7c721518e472a82f05 OP_EQUAL
address
3Cm5KmGKGqU9JUW1UJR8kSKWaEjr2T9t8k
transaction
84fe558ef90108a02131f0e406b9f5162c8d14cb4ae9565fce0b0247b6f1ff11
spent
true